Traditional problems with reliable picket sash windows include things like rot, swelling or distortion of the woodwork[6] or rattling from the wind (as a result of shrinkage with the Wooden).[seven] These issues might be solved by thorough repair and also the introduction of draught stripping. It is also a common issue for painters to paint the sash stuck. The sliding mechanism tends to make sash windows a lot more susceptible to these challenges than regular casement windows.

Small cracking or flaking in paintwork is a common issue which really should be looked at just about every 5 or so decades for exterior paintwork. Because the paint safeguards the timber beneath, trying to keep a organization eye on any deterioration will make sure the frames gained’t rot or swell.

A traditional sash window is usually a moveable glazed panel (there tend to be two) that’s equipped into two vertical grooves within the timber window frames. This permits the sashes to move upwards and downwards freely.

An alternative choice for anybody following a Do it yourself system to draught evidence sash windows is to implement metallic or plastic strips with brushes or pile strips connected — often known as brush seals or strips.
